The Bianchi Arcadex PRO is a high-performance carbon gravel bike designed for those seeking speed, control, and the ability to tackle demanding terrain without compromise. It is a modern bicycle that combines racing gravel geometry, total integration, and front suspension, conceived for long distances, rough surfaces, and fast technical routes.
The Arcadex PRO carbon frame is designed for flat mount disc brakes and utilizes modern standards such as the PressFit 86.5x41 bottom bracket and 12x142 mm rear thru-axle. Compatibility with the SRAM UDH rear derailleur makes it ready for the most advanced drivetrains, while the absence of a front derailleur underscores the 1x philosophy oriented towards simplicity, reliability, and off-road performance.
The RockShox Rudy XPLR suspension fork with 30 mm of travel increases traction, control, and comfort on rough terrain, enhancing stability and steering precision when speed increases on fast gravel roads and technical sections.
The wireless electronic drivetrain combines SRAM Apex AXS HRD controls with the GX Eagle Transmission T-Type AXS derailleur, offering robust, precise shifting designed for heavy-duty use. The 40T chainring paired with the 10-52T cassette guarantees an extremely wide range, ideal for steep climbs and fast sections.
The Velomann Terbium 30 mm carbon wheels with a 25 mm internal channel work in synergy with the Pirelli Cinturato Gravel M 45 mm tires, offering grip, comfort, and stability even on rough or mixed terrain.
A performance gravel bike conceived for those who want a fast yet capable bicycle, perfect for gravel races, long adventures, and high-speed technical routes.
Technical Specifications:
Frame
Frame: Arcadex PRO
Brakes: flat mount 140/160
Bottom Bracket: PressFit 86.5 x Ø41
Rear Axle: 12x142 mm thru-axle
Front Derailleur: not supported
Rear Derailleur: SRAM UDH standard
Fork
Model: RockShox Rudy XPLR
Travel: 30 mm
Brakes: flat mount 160/180
Front Axle: 12x100 mm thru-axle
Tire Clearance: up to ETRTO 622-50 mm
Steerer Tube: tapered 1 1/8"
Headset
Bianchi Custom Acros ICR
Integrated cable routing
Drivetrain
Controls: SRAM Apex AXS HRD
Derailleur: SRAM GX Eagle Transmission T-Type AXS
Crankset: SRAM Rival 1 Wide 40T
Crank Lengths:
• 170 mm (XS/SM)
• 172.5 mm (MD/LG)
• 175 mm (XL)
Bottom Bracket: SRAM DUB PressFit Road Wide 86.5 x Ø41
Chain: SRAM GX Eagle Transmission Flattop
Cassette: SRAM GX Eagle Transmission XS 1272 T-Type 10-52T
Freehub Body: XD
Brakes
System: SRAM Apex
Pads: organic with steel backing
Rotors: SRAM CenterLine Centerlock
Diameter: 160 mm front and rear
Wheels
Model: Velomann Terbium
Type: clincher / tubeless ready
Diameter: 700C
Material: carbon
Profile: 30 mm
Internal Channel: 25 mm
Tires: Pirelli Cinturato Gravel M Classic
Size: 45-622 tan sidewall
Cockpit
Stem: Velomann aluminum AICR
Angle: -2°
Steerer Diameter: 28.6 mm
Bar Clamp Diameter: 31.8 mm
Stem Lengths:
• 80 mm XS
• 90 mm SM
• 100 mm MD
• 110 mm LG
• 120 mm XL
Handlebar: Velomann Gravel ICR aluminum
Flare: 16°
Drop: 130 mm
Reach: 70 mm
Widths:
• 400 mm XS/SM
• 420 mm MD/LG
• 440 mm XL
Bar Tape: Bianchi Hexagon 2.5 mm black
Saddle and Seatpost
Seatpost: Velomann Carbon UD Ø27.2
Lengths:
• 300 mm XS
• 350 mm SM/MD/LG/XL
Saddle: Velomann MITORA 149 H1
Length: 250 mm
Width: 149 mm
Weight: 230 g ±2
Rails: AISI
